What are the Common Signs that the Water Heater is Going Out?

The most common signs of a failing water heater are sudden leaks, a reduction in hot water levels, and rust in the water. It is these conditions that can indicate serious damage inside the tank, and the damage could lead to a serious flood inside the property.

How are Tankless Water Heaters Different?

Tankless water heaters don’t require a tank, and they will fit in more confined spaces than standard water heaters. The systems heat water as needed instead of pulling a higher volume of water into the tank to produce hot water. Overall, this could lower water costs for the homeowner, and they can acquire hot water when they need it.
